Greater Noida, UP: A shocking incident unfolded at Gautam Buddha University (GBU) in Greater Noida, where a second-year BA student, Dheeraj Tiwari, jumped from the roof of his hostel, resulting in his death. The university authorities immediately informed the Ecotech-1 Police Station, and the injured student was rushed to JIMS Hospital, where doctors declared him dead. Details of the IncidentThe deceased, Dheeraj Tiwari, aged 30, was a resident of Sonipat, Haryana, and was pursuing a BA in Psychology at GBU. He was staying at the Ramsharan Das Hostel on campus. According to preliminary police reports, Dheeraj jumped from the hostel roof for reasons yet unknown. The initial investigation suggests that the incident appears to be a case of suicide. Meerut, UP: Following the recent terrorist blast at Delhi’s Red Fort, authorities have placed the entire state on high alert. The Meerut zone has been categorized as a highly sensitive area, and special scrutiny has been initiated on Kashmiri students studying in local colleges and universities. According to official sources, nearly 600 Kashmiri students are enrolled across various institutions in the Meerut zone, including Subharti University, Shobhit University, and the Agriculture University, among others. Due to security concerns, the exact number of students at each institution is being kept confidential. Bhopal, MP: In a shocking revelation, a major job fraud racket has come to light in Bhopal, where a man allegedly swindled nearly Rs 20 lakh from unsuspecting people by promising them government jobs. The accused, Vijay Shankar Mishra, reportedly claimed that his sister-in-law was an IAS officer posted in a state ministry and that he could secure government positions for applicants. How the Scam UnfoldedThe case came to light when several victims realized that the joining letters handed to them were fake. The accused targeted residents of Ambah, Morena, including a farmer named Rajkumar Singh, who approached him on February 6, 2024, outside a government ministry. Bhopal, MP: In a tragic incident from Badhjiri village, Rathibad, Bhopal, a 17-year-old girl reportedly took her own life after being scolded by her mother for skipping school. The shocking case highlights the vulnerability of teenagers to extreme emotional responses. Incident DetailsThe deceased has been identified as Payal Tilak, a Class 12 student and daughter of Suresh Tilak. According to family members, Payal had not attended school on Tuesday. When her mother asked for the reason, Payal did not respond. The mother’s subsequent scolding reportedly left the teenager upset and emotionally distressed. Khargone, MP: A health scare has gripped Piparad village in the Bhikangaon sub-division of Khargone district, Madhya Pradesh, as over 150 villagers have fallen ill due to suspected consumption of contaminated tap water. The local administration and health authorities have rushed teams to contain the situation and provide immediate medical assistance. Survey and ResponseAccording to SDM Akanksha Karothiya, officials from the Health, Public Health Engineering (PHE), Revenue, and Panchayat Departments conducted a door-to-door survey of affected households. Out of 464 homes surveyed, 167 residents reported symptoms including nausea, loose motions, and abdominal pain. Pandhurna, MP: A mysterious outbreak in Hivar Prithviram village of Pandhurna district has put the local community on high alert. Following the sudden death of 15 cattle, five villagers—two children and three adults—fell ill after consuming milk from the infected cows. The Chhindwara Animal Disease Research Laboratory has confirmed that the deaths were caused by a Gram-positive cocci bacterial infection, a pathogen that spreads through contaminated milk, water, or fodder. Forensic FindingsForensic tests conducted on samples from the deceased animals revealed the presence of the harmful Gram-positive bacteria, which can be highly infectious. Ashoknagar, MP: A violent dispute over land in Ashoknagar district turned deadly when two brothers clashed over farming rights on 8 bighas of land, resulting in the death of their father and nephew. Several others sustained injuries and were hospitalized, with one critically injured person referred to Bhopal for further treatment. Police have received complaints from both sides and are conducting a detailed investigation. Incident DetailsThe incident occurred on Wednesday afternoon around 3:00 PM in Karaiya Banet village under Rajpur police post. The conflict arose over farmland registered in the father’s name. Satna: In the wake of the recent car blast in Delhi, Satna police have heightened vigilance across the district. During this period, a fake video claiming terrorist activity in Satna went viral on social media, causing panic among residents. The Kolagwan police have arrested a 23-year-old youth in connection with the misleading post. The Incident:The accused, identified as Ravi Kumar Tiwari, posted a sensational claim on his Facebook story, asserting that “three terrorists are hiding in Satna” and suggesting that the next attack could target the city following the Delhi blast. Bhopal: Madhya Pradesh is witnessing record-breaking cold this season, with several districts experiencing temperatures well below normal. Kalyanpur in Shahdol district recorded a chilling 6.9°C, making it the coldest location in the country’s plains. Indore and Rajgarh also reported low temperatures of 7°C, ranking among the coldest cities in India, while the state capital Bhopal recorded 8°C, placing it eighth nationally. Severe Cold Wave Sweeps the StateThe past 24 hours have seen extreme cold envelop many districts in Madhya Pradesh. Indore registered 7°C, emerging as the coldest city in the plains, closely followed by Rajgarh at 7°C. Jodhpur/Jaipur: In a major development in the high-profile Anandpal Singh encounter case, a court in Jodhpur has granted relief to police officers, including IPS officer Rahul Barhat, who were facing charges of murder. The decision overturns a previous order by the ACJM (CBI Cases) Court in Jodhpur, which had directed that a case be registered against the officers. Background of the EncounterOn the night of June 24, 2017, the police conducted an operation in a house in Malasar village, Churu district, targeting the notorious gangster Anandpal Singh. Prior to the encounter, police had arrested Anandpal’s brother, Rupinder Pal Singh, and his close associate Devendra Singh in Haryana.
